Skip to content

Conversation

@a-detiste
Copy link
Contributor

No description provided.

@a-detiste
Copy link
Contributor Author

ping

@pgajdos
Copy link

pgajdos commented Aug 28, 2024

Please consider to accept this PR.

@a-detiste
Copy link
Contributor Author

funcsigs should go too...

bmwiedemann pushed a commit to bmwiedemann/openSUSE that referenced this pull request Sep 9, 2024
https://build.opensuse.org/request/show/1197230
by user StevenK + dimstar_suse
- Switch to pyproject macros.

- drop python 2 support, do not require six
- added patches
  fix rubik/mando#57
  + python-mando-no-python2.patch
@rubik rubik merged commit 211211c into rubik:master Oct 20, 2024
@rubik
Copy link
Owner

rubik commented Oct 20, 2024

@a-detiste Apologies for the delay. Thank you for your contribution.

@a-detiste
Copy link
Contributor Author

Thank you very much. It will take years to remove stray six usage, even in codebases that are not even Python2 compatible anymore.

In comparaison python3-funcsigs was removed pretty fast from Debian, like a two weeks job.

I will provide a second PR, or you can apply this patch (it was needed as a workaround in the bug in the release tooling, not even in Mando itself, but as it was the last user of funcsigs it was the most practical thing to do):

https://salsa.debian.org/python-team/packages/mando/-/commit/8b6db4beedf6cab73a0d7d995f12cf41d387c6d3

@rubik
Copy link
Owner

rubik commented Oct 20, 2024

Thank you Alexandre! I'll apply that patch and release another minor version.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ants